Been a while since I had a D3, but all things being equal sounds about right.
Diesel engines are more thermally efficient than petrol, so much so that they often need an auxiliary heater so you don't have to sit in a cold car for ages in the winter! On the D3, that is diesel fueled and sits on the coolant circuit. In the summer this won't activate, so 12 miles to get "warm" doesn't seem unusual? |

Sounds like your Aux heater aint working, which isn't uncommon.
D3 4.2 TDi should heat up reasonably quickly. D4 4.2 Tdi they did away with the engine heater, and put electric elements in the air flow to the cabin instead, so the engine takes ages to warm up, but you get warmth in the cabin straight away. |
